Hi all,

I just added my laptop to my account but BOINC won't download any WUs. The only problem I see is that the BOINC client is returning I have 0 MB of free BOINC disk space. My preferences are set up just fine (use up to 5 Gigs, and up to 50% of available free space) and I did not have this problem with my first two computers that are running BOINC w/o any problems. Any ideas how I open up free space on my laptop so that WUs will download?

I'm running 4.09 on my two desktops, but 4.13 on my laptop. Could this have anything to do with it? Any info will be appreciated.

On average, a new client can take up to an hour before it starts to d/l WUs.

Leave the laptop alone on the network for a bit (not in standby or sleep mode, of course) and it will eventually grabs some WUs on its own.
